[kernel][ICS][23/05/2012] mnics (LR/CM9)

  • 317 Antworten
  • Letztes Antwortdatum
Ich kann bei CM9 nach wie vor die Werte im Color Tuning (so heißt das da) ändern, d.h. dass es sich nicht um Voodoo Color sondern um CM Color handelt (die haben da was anderes eingebaut).
Mit der Voodoo-App lässt sich da nichts mehr einstellen.
 
mialwe schrieb:
Voodoo: Was genau wird gewünscht? Der Treiber entspricht den Voodoo-Nexustreibern, die RGB Multiplier auch, nur Gamma habe ich zu einem Regler vereint (die RGB-Gammas) - Bedienung so einfach wie möglich, ausserdem Grenzwerte um Grünstich zu verhindern.
Wenn man die ROM-Colorcontrols verwendet sollte bei den Meisten ICS-ROMs auch getrennte Gammaregelung möglich sein.

Genau wie Uwe bereits geschrieben hat, kann man in der Voodoo App nichts einstellen was die Farbwerte/Gamma betrifft. Ich komme mit den CMC settings einfach nicht auf die Voodoo Werte/Farben so wie ich das ungefähr eingestellt habe. Weiß ist einfach kein weiß bei mir und mit einem Voodoo kernel passte das immer sofort. Weiß nicht genau was da der Unterschied ist. Es fehlen ja eben auch die adaptiven Gamma settings unter CMC.
 
mialwe schrieb:
War das mit Night-Mode oder im Normalmodus?


Hallo,

ganz normale Standardeinstellung nach frischer Installation des Kernels.
Nix angefasst......

Das Phänomen hatte ich allerdings vorgestern auch beim Damian-Kernel, Vortex 4 Alpha, der hat auch wie wild hell---dunkel geregelt.

Ich werde Deinen Kernel noch mal auf die neue v7 meiner ROM "schmeissen".
Mal gucken, ob das reproduzierbar ist, ansonsten funktioniert Dein Kernel nämlich wirklich 1a

https://www.android-hilfe.de/forum/...gnex-stock-rom-von-elite-15-06-12.213741.html
 
Ok, vom Sourcecode her sieht CM colors zumindest ähnlich aus wie VoodooColor, basiert wohl auch darauf: Committext in https://github.com/teamhacksung/samsung-kernel-aries/commit/02ec59ed19ef25e9e8863ca85da071d71cf9f81c bei Teamhacksung.

Welche Regler angeboten werden liegt wohl am ROM- und Kerneldev, die Sysfs-Dateien RGB, Gamma-RGB sind bei Midnight alle vorhanden, sind aber eben die von Teamhacksung angepassten die mit VC nicht kompatibel sind.

Das führt mich direkt zu dem Problem was mich bei ICS von Anfang an beschäftigt: Dank Cyanogenmod/Teamhacksung *haben* wir überhaupt ICS auf unserem SGS.

ABER: Seit CM9/ICS werden in den ROM-Settings immer mehr Kernel-Einstellungen eingebaut (ich weiss z.B. bis jetzt noch nicht welche CM/ICS-Einstellung mir den LED timeout überschreibt wenn ich ihn in der Initramfs setze, nur per MidnightControl funktioniert das da späterer Zeitpunkt). Folge: Beim Kernelbauen muss ich aufpassen was passiert wenn ich da etwas ändere um nicht irgendwo FCs auszulösen. Käme jetzt auf einen Versuch an was VoodooColor-Kompatibilität in den CW-Settings (die Color-Settings würden dann ja nicht mehr funktionieren) auslösen würde. Vorerst habe ich das nicht geplant, evtl. werde ich aber die Gammaregler trennen.

Wenn ich auf VoodooColor umstellen würde hätte ich das gleiche Problem wahrscheinlich mit CM-Color-Nutzern. Ich kann es nicht allen Recht machen, egal was ich anstelle.
 
Zuletzt bearbeitet:
  • Danke
Reaktionen: tobiasth, matze6989 und scheichuwe
mialwe schrieb:
Wie schaltest Du die 800Mhz ein? Diesen Teil verstehe ich nicht ganz. UV+Reboots ist ein klassisches Symptom dass Frequenz und eingestellte Volt nicht zusammenpassen, das würde passen. Aber "Einschalten" ?

Bootlogo: Nein, zu viel Arbeit für zu wenig Sinn - das Teil ist nach ein paar Sekunden sowiso wieder unsichtbar. Small & simple, so bleibt das. Auseedem sollte ien Logo meiner Meinung nach so einfach wie möglich gehalten sein (einfach reproduzierbar, leicht wiedererkennbar, unkompliziert), nicht unbedingt ein ganzes "Bild".

Voodoo: Was genau wird gewünscht? Der Treiber entspricht den Voodoo-Nexustreibern, die RGB Multiplier auch, nur Gamma habe ich zu einem Regler vereint (die RGB-Gammas) - Bedienung so einfach wie möglich, ausserdem Grenzwerte um Grünstich zu verhindern.
Wenn man die ROM-Colorcontrols verwendet sollte bei den Meisten ICS-ROMs auch getrennte Gammaregelung möglich sein.

Also wenn ich im Midnight Control die cpu maximal frequenz auf 800Mhz stelle (sonst bleibt alles unverändert) und das handy dann neu starte, fährt es hoch bis "galaxy s kernel loading" und danach ist ende, der bildschirm bleibt schwarz mit ein paar bunten strichen.
 
  • Danke
Reaktionen: mialwe
Ok, das ist vielleicht wirklich ein Bug, muss ich mir mal ansehen. Dankeschön :)
 
Ich habe absolut keine probleme damit...alles bestens.

Gesendet von meinem GT-I9000 mit der Android-Hilfe.de App
 
Ich nutze leider kein autobrightness... ;)

via SGS
 
hallo
Hast du schonmal darüber nachgedacht touchwake zu integrieren? ich persönlich finds klasse und bleib deshalb vorerst beim devil :)

Sent from my GT-I9000 using Tapatalk
 
Ja, an Touchwake wäre eher noch interessant als DIDLE (für mich zumindest). Wenn alles andere rund läuft werde versuchen Ezekeels Code zu portieren soweit nötig. Im Grunde möchte ich allerdings nichts riskieren was die Stabilität beeinträchtigen könnte - Midnight soll so stabil wie möglich laufen, das hat oberste Priorität für mich.
 
  • Danke
Reaktionen: scheichuwe und kryox
So, heute noch mal den Midnight getestet, nix mehr festgestellt wegen der Autobrightness, ist wohl was schiefgelaufen beim ersten Mal, nun alles bei 100%

Danke für den tollen Kernel
 
  • Danke
Reaktionen: mialwe
Und ich bin hier am Fehlersuchen... :)
Wäre aber trotzdem interessant zu wissen *was* es jetzt nun war. Danke für's nochmal ausprobieren.

Egal, die Brightnessformel werde ich wohl noch bissl vereinfachen so dass

1) die Helligkeit im Normalmodus überhaupt nicht angetastet wird,
2) eine benutzerdefinierte Minimalhelligkeit aber erhalten bleibt (falls jemandem Stock-Min.brightness zu dunkel/hell ist)
3) und im Nachtmodus dann alles auf Minimum gefahren wird.

Je einfacher desto besser.

EDIT: Muss ich wohl nochmal überdenken, ohne die Filterformel lässt sich die Helligkeit ja nicht absenken... d.h. Punkt 2 funktioniert in der vereinfachten Form nicht...
 
Zuletzt bearbeitet:
  • Danke
Reaktionen: Olley und kingoftf
Hallo mialwe, dein Kernel kommt jetzt auch Hier zum Einsatz!
screenheutepzk4o.png

 
mialwe schrieb:
Und ich bin hier am Fehlersuchen... :)
Wäre aber trotzdem interessant zu wissen *was* es jetzt nun war. Danke für's nochmal ausprobieren.

Egal, die Brightnessformel werde ich wohl noch bissl vereinfachen so dass

1) die Helligkeit im Normalmodus überhaupt nicht angetastet wird,
2) eine benutzerdefinierte Minimalhelligkeit aber erhalten bleibt (falls jemandem Stock-Min.brightness zu dunkel/hell ist)
3) und im Nachtmodus dann alles auf Minimum gefahren wird.

Je einfacher desto besser.

EDIT: Muss ich wohl nochmal überdenken, ohne die Filterformel lässt sich die Helligkeit ja nicht absenken... d.h. Punkt 2 funktioniert in der vereinfachten Form nicht...

ich versteh das Problem jetzt garnicht ?

wenns dunkel ist ist display auch dunkel wenns draussen hell ist wirds schlagartig auch hell...so soll das doch funktionieren oder nicht ?

ich nutze nämlich auch nur auto helligleit und das funktioniert doch super:thumbup:
 
Geht mir auch o, Autobrightness fast zu 99% genutzt, manuell nur noch zum Testen.
Die Formel die Midnight zum absenken der Helligkeiten nutzt ist eigentlich "überdimensioniert" für die genutzte Funktionalität (Min.brightness im Nachtmodus), damit könnte man eigentlich auch die Helligkeiten stufenweise runterregeln (wie in Midnight GB). Das werde ich in MN-ICS nicht mehr einbauen (würde die App zu kompliziert machen, Midnight soll so einfach wie möglich zu bedienen sein/werden), demnach habe ich überlegt wie ich das vereinfachen könnte. Egal, wird erstmal belassen wie es ist. Wie immer Zeitmangel.
 
  • Danke
Reaktionen: Olley
mialwe schrieb:
Geht mir auch o, Autobrightness fast zu 99% genutzt, manuell nur noch zum Testen.
Die Formel die Midnight zum absenken der Helligkeiten nutzt ist eigentlich "überdimensioniert" für die genutzte Funktionalität (Min.brightness im Nachtmodus), damit könnte man eigentlich auch die Helligkeiten stufenweise runterregeln (wie in Midnight GB). Das werde ich in MN-ICS nicht mehr einbauen (würde die App zu kompliziert machen, Midnight soll so einfach wie möglich zu bedienen sein/werden), demnach habe ich überlegt wie ich das vereinfachen könnte. Egal, wird erstmal belassen wie es ist. Wie immer Zeitmangel.

Bist du der echte dev des Kernels

P.s. der Kernel ist ja mal richtig geil

Gesendet von meinem GT-I9000 mit Tapatalk
 
hehe ja Mialwe ist der echte dev des midnight
 
Komisch komisch...mialwe redet immer von zeitmangel aber hat trotzdem mit den ersten wurf in mein augen den besten kernel. naja und den besten support. :) hehe

Gesendet von meinem GT-I9000 mit der Android-Hilfe.de App
 
Dafür habe ich auch ein *etwas* grösseres Schlafdefizit. Irgendwann muss ich ja auch am Kernel arbeiten.

Wobei ich mit Midnight-ICS die Menge an Zeit die in die Kernelentwicklung fliessen deutlich reduzieren will bzw. bereits reduziert habe.
Auch wenn es vielleicht manchen Benutzern nicht gefallen wird - Midnight-ICS wird gerade die Features haben die ich persönlich interessant/nützlich finde, dazu einige Sachen aus Midnight-GB - aber wohl nicht mehr.
Wenn alles rund läuft und eingebaut ist wird es wohl ruhiger werden um Midnight-ICS.
 
  • Danke
Reaktionen: Onkel Ede, matze6989 und scheichuwe

Ähnliche Themen

B
  • blackburn73
Antworten
0
Aufrufe
2.041
blackburn73
B
M
  • Gesperrt
  • marvel_master
Antworten
2
Aufrufe
2.489
Wattsolls
Wattsolls
Bödi
Antworten
3
Aufrufe
3.234
Muppi
Muppi
Zurück
Oben Unten